Boeing Welcomes Virgin Australia as Newest 737 MAX 10 Customer

Australian airline expands capacity by converting ten MAX 8s to the larger MAX 10 model Boeing [NYSE:BA] and the Virgin Australia Group [ASX:VAH] announced the airline is adding the largest and most efficient member of the 737 MAX family to its growing single-aisle fleet. Delta named among Fast Company"™s Most Innovative Companies for 2018

Delta has been named one of Fast Company’s Most Innovative Companies Worldwide in 2018. The airline’s use of RFID technology to track customer bags in real time earned it the No. 6 spot among travel companies.
